The Edmonton Motorcycle Roadracing Association Gets Set to Hold Its Rounds of the Western Canadian Championships!

September 5,6,7 will see the EMRA host its two rounds of the Western Canadian Championships at the new Castrol Raceway in Edmonton, Alberta, Canada. That weekend will also conclude the EMRA’s 6 round schedule.

Many classes have been closely contested throughout the season at Castrol’s developing new road course. Expert Superbike is setting up to be another exciting battle to the last checkered flag, with Justin Knapik having a chance at wrapping up not only Expert Superbike, but the overall track championship as well! Fast up and comer Shane Caravan will be looking to continue his dominating season aboard his Yamaha R1 trying to clinch the Intermediate Superbike championship. Caravan has battled through some major crashes and serious injuries this season and yet has managed to put on a performance that not many could have expected.

With riders and teams from across western Canada expected to embark on Castrol Raceway for the event, this will be a weekend that not many will want to miss.
